  • Title
    Letter from Ministry of Agriculture & Fisheries. Have received an objection to the proposed altered appointment from H.J. Webber, on behalf of the executors of W.J. Smith. The conveyance of Home Farm, Westoning to W.A. Horsley in 1932 was subject to the purchaser paying the whole tithe rent charge on the property conveyed and certain other land. Ampthill RDC have informed that the land conveyed to them was ‘tithe free’. Messrs B.J. Smith, R.A. Baker, T. Gazeley and Mrs E. Gazeley also claim to have been indemnified against paying rent charge when they purchased their property.
